Graukopfnonne vs Spitzschwanz-Bronzemännchen
Lonchura caniceps compared with Lonchura striata
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Graukopfnonne | Spitzschwanz-Bronzemännchen |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class same | Aves (Vögel) | Aves (Vögel) |
| Order same | Passeriformes (Sperlingsvögel) | Passeriformes (Sperlingsvögel) |
| Family same | Estrildidae | Estrildidae |
| Genus same | Lonchura | Lonchura |
| Species | Lonchura caniceps | Lonchura striata |
Evolutionary Relationship
Graukopfnonne and Spitzschwanz-Bronzemännchen share a common ancestor at the Genus level: Lonchura.
